Veranda Sealing in Kitsap County, WA
Veranda sealing services involve applying protective coatings to outdoor porch and balcony structures to enhance their durability and appearance. This process is commonly used on wood, composite, or concrete verandas to prevent damage from moisture, UV rays, and general wear over time. Projects typically include sealing existing verandas, restoring older surfaces, or preparing new installations to extend their lifespan and maintain their visual appeal. Homeowners often seek this service to safeguard their outdoor living spaces, reduce maintenance needs, and preserve the structural integrity of their verandas.
Before requesting veranda sealing, property owners should consider the current condition of their outdoor surfaces, including any signs of damage or wear. It’s important to understand the types of sealants suitable for different materials and the recommended frequency of reapplication to ensure ongoing protection. Additionally, knowing whether the surface requires cleaning or repairs prior to sealing can help achieve the best results. Clear communication about the scope of the project and any specific concerns will assist in selecting the appropriate sealing solutions for a long-lasting, attractive veranda.

Veranda Sealing Questions
What is veranda sealing? Veranda sealing involves applying a protective coating to the surface to prevent water damage and extend its lifespan.
When should a veranda be sealed? Sealing is recommended when the surface shows signs of wear, such as fading or minor cracking, or as part of regular maintenance.
What types of materials can be sealed on a veranda? Common materials include wood, composite, and concrete surfaces on verandas and decks.
How does sealing benefit a veranda? Sealing helps protect against moisture, UV damage, and staining, keeping the surface looking and performing its best.
